Which steps are typically included in the personnel selection process? (Select all that apply) Multiple select question. Review

work samples. Screen applications. Generate job descriptions. Interview candidates. Review progress. Check references.

Steps that are typically included in the personnel selection process are:

  • Check references
  • Interview candidates
  • Screen applications
  • Review work samples

<h3>What is personnel selection process?</h3>

personnel selection process can be regarded as the  process involving allocation of the right men on right job.

it entails seeking for the best hand to meet organizational requirements with the skills and qualifications.
